very obvious what RMB is saying. disagree with him on saying Liverpool are a genuine 1.4x shot but can't argue with his trading

put it simply for those who don't understand:

If you put £100 on at 1.58 and lay to win £50 at 1.48 then your position is +£34, -£50, hence average 1.7

Say you have £100 on a horse at 6.0, potential profit/loss = £500 (£100) .:. average price (profit to loss ratio) = 6.0
If you lay £50 off at 4.0 IR, potential profit/loss = £350 (£50) .:. average price (profit to loss ratio) = 8.0
